We are seeking a Drama Teacher for a fantastic opportunity to join a thriving school in Dudley. The school is looking for a dynamic and highly capable Drama Teacher to join a popular, successful, and expanding department.

School Information

  • The school has a well-deserved reputation for academic excellence, amazing pastoral care and policies followed to the letter.
  • The school is a popular 11-18 co-educational school with a strong family and community ethos.
  • These values are the foundation of learning for their students, providing them with an academic start to life that is supportive, nurturing, and inspiring.

Experience and Qualifications

  • Degree in Drama
  • PGCE or QTS
  • Drama Teacher to KS5

Salary

The salary for this Drama Teacher position will be paid to scale on a permanent contract to scale MPS/UPS.

How to prepare for a job interview at Wayman Learning Trust

Know Your Stuff

Make sure you brush up on your drama theory and teaching methods. Be ready to discuss your favourite plays, techniques, and how you engage students in the subject. This shows your passion and expertise!

Showcase Your Creativity

Prepare to share some innovative lesson ideas or projects you've implemented in the past. Think about how you can bring fresh energy to the department and inspire students. A little creativity goes a long way!

Connect with Their Values

Familiarise yourself with the school's ethos and values. During the interview, highlight how your teaching style aligns with their commitment to pastoral care and community. This will demonstrate that you're a great fit for their environment.

Ask Thoughtful Questions

Prepare some insightful questions about the school’s drama programme and future plans. This not only shows your interest but also helps you gauge if the school is the right place for you. It’s a two-way street!
